/* ABOUTME: Styles for content block items within the slider section. */
/* ABOUTME: Controls card background colors and text styling for slider items. */
.content_wrapper--slider .item {
	background-color: var(--card-bg-color);
	color: var(--card-text-color, currentColor);
}

.section--card-background-colored .content_wrapper--slider .item {
	border-radius: var(--rbr);
	overflow: hidden;
}
.content_wrapper--slider .item .item-blocks {
	display: flex;
	flex-direction: column;
	gap: 1rem;
}
.section--card-background-colored .content_wrapper--slider .item .item-blocks {
	padding-inline: 1rem;
	padding-bottom: 1rem;
}

@media screen and (min-width: 654px) and (max-width: 1024px) {
	.section--content_blocks .content_wrapper--slider.items-count-2 .item {
		flex-direction: row;
	}

	.section--content_blocks
		.content_wrapper--slider.items-count-2
		.item:last-child {
		flex-direction: row-reverse;
	}
	.section--content_blocks .content_wrapper--slider.items-count-2 .item > * {
		width: 100%;
	}
}
